Output f2a75e9d3d7f1a0070d02af62d75cb6de2272457d5a23a6abaf54f9242599bea:0

value
960977604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ae8893322f76571f5b49a45256326629ea80a09 OP_EQUAL
address
38X6VcsfFi2EB9q2GnwacypBXUM4BB96LP
transaction
f2a75e9d3d7f1a0070d02af62d75cb6de2272457d5a23a6abaf54f9242599bea
confirmations
521993
spent
true